Default Confused

Its my understanding that when you get performance headers that they are supposed to bolt right in with no modifications. I say this because my brother in law has a 2002 neon atx and just installed his headers but two of the exhaust ports wouldn't line up...... his solution was to pry the two ports open more then install it. this has gotta eventually cause damage to the headers and even the head right?

Default RE: Confused

Most headers don't just bolt-in. There may be some cutting required to the stock exhaust. But it should bolt up to the head.
